Formed in 1972 in the very city in which this show was recorded, five years later, Van Halen were credited with "restoring hard rock to the forefront of the music scene". From 1974 until 1985, Van Halen consisted of Eddie Van Halen; Eddie's brother, drummer Alex Van Halen; vocalist David Lee Roth; and bassist Michael Anthony, and it was this prestigious line up that performed in the group's home city in 1977, when they gave their all at the Pasadena Civic Auditorium, on December 20th 1977. Playing a stunning set just a couple of months before the band's superb debut album was released (in February 1978), the entire affair was recorded for live FM radio broadcast. Now featured in its entirety on this CD for the first time, this pivotal early gig remains quite probably the best concert the group put on during this time in their career.
